The A2Z Market Research report on “Global Fiber Bragg Grating Arrays and Cables Market Report 2022 – Future Opportunities, Latest Trends, In-depth Analysis, and Forecast To 2029†offers strategic visions into the global Fiber Bragg Grating Arrays and Cables market along with the market size (Volume – Million Units and Revenue – US$ Billion) and estimates for the duration 2022 to 2029. The said research study covers in-depth analysis of multiple market segments based on type, application, and studies different topographies. The report is also inclusive of competitive profiling of the leading Fiber Bragg Grating Arrays and Cables product vendors, and their latest developments.
This report has been segmented by type, by application and by geography and also includes the market size and forecast for all these segments. Compounded annual growth rates for all segments have also been provided for 2022 to 2029. The study highlights current market trends for Fiber Bragg Grating Arrays and Cables and also provides the future trends that will impact the demand. Year-on-year growth rates are also provided for each segment covered in the global Fiber Bragg Grating Arrays and Cables market report. The report also analyzes the market from production perspective and includes raw material cost analysis, technology cost analysis, labor cost analysis, and cost overview for the Fiber Bragg Grating Arrays and Cables market.
By geography, the market has been segmented into North America, South America, Asia, Europe, Africa and Others. Under North America, the report covers the United States, and Canada; whereas Asia includes China, Japan, India, Korea, and Southeast Asia. The key countries covered under Europe include Germany, United Kingdom, France, and Russia whereas ‘Others’ is comprised of Middle East and GCC countries. The present market size and forecast till 2029 for all the regions and sub-regions have also been provided in the report.
